is the model of bernoulli trials plausible in each of the following situations? Discuss in what manner (if any) a serious violation of the assumptions can occur.

Seven friends go to a blockbuster movie and each is asked whether the movie was excellent

A musical aptitude test is given to 10 students and the times to complete the test are recorded.

1.) No Bernoulli trails are not plausible. Though, the response from each of seven friends will be 0 or 1, 1 if movie was excellent and 0 otherwise, but the probability that movie was excellent depends on each of the people. Someone liked it or someone else didn't. So, probability is not the same in all trials, therefore violating the condition of Bernoulli trials.But if we assume that probability that movie was excellent was predecided and same forever, than this can be considered as bernoulli trials

2.) Since, time recorded for each student can be in minutes and not taking only two values ( say 0 or 1 ), therefore the values are not binary, hence trials are not Bernoulli
